Setting to unfold email chains
I have a lot of forum emails (which is great, I don't want to change this). But if I haven't been keeping up with the discussion, I have to individually tap on each new message in the chain to read it.
Moreover, unexpanded messages are marked as unread, but if I open the chain, then I consider that to have "read" the chain.
It would be great if new messages could be expanded by default. It's a little thing, but it's driving me wild- a setting for this behavior would be much appreciated
